onkeldom.victoriametrics

Rol de Ansible: VictoriaMetrics

ubuntu-18 ubuntu-20 debian-9 debian-10

Licencia Problemas en GitHub Etiqueta en GitHub

Descripción

Despliega el sistema de monitoreo victoriametrics utilizando ansible.

Requisitos

  • Ansible >= 2.9 (Puede funcionar en versiones anteriores, pero no lo garantizamos)

Variables del Rol

Todas las variables que se pueden sobrescribir están almacenadas en el archivo defaults/main.yml así como en la tabla a continuación.

Nombre Valor por defecto Descripción
proxy_env {} Variables de entorno del proxy
victoriametrics_version 1.57.1 Versión del paquete victoriametrics. También acepta latest como parámetro. Solo se admite victoriametrics 2.x
victoriametrics_config_dir /etc/victoriametrics Ruta al directorio de configuración de victoriametrics
victoriametrics_data_dir /var/lib/victoriametrics Ruta al directorio de la base de datos de victoriametrics
victoriametrics_binary_install_dir /usr/local/bin Ruta al directorio de los binarios de victoriametrics
victoriametrics_system_user prometheus Usuario del sistema para victoriametrics
victoriametrics_system_group victoriametrics Grupo del sistema para victoriametrics
victoriametrics_limit_nofile 16384 Establecer el límite nofile en la unidad systemd
victoriametrics_web_listen_address "0.0.0.0" Dirección en la que victoriametrics estará escuchando
victoriametrics_web_listen_port 8428 Puerto en el que victoriametrics estará escuchando
victoriametrics_log_level warn Establecer el nivel de registro
victoriametrics_log_format json Establecer el formato de registro
victoriametrics_prometheus_config {} Definir la configuración de prometheus
victoriametrics_config [] Definir variables de entorno de victoriametrics - Lista de Flags

Ejemplo

Playbook

---
- hosts: all
  roles:
  - onkeldom.victoriametrics

Contribuciones

Consulta la guía para contribuyentes.

Licencia

Este proyecto tiene licencia bajo la Licencia MIT. Consulta LICENSE para más detalles.

Acerca del proyecto

Ansible role for installing and configuring victoriametrics storage backend

Instalar
ansible-galaxy install onkeldom.victoriametrics
Licencia
mit
Descargas
440
Propietario